Main Facts: The New Standard of Power
The current market for wireless charging is defined by a shift toward Qi2 certification. Developed by the Wireless Power Consortium with significant input from Apple, Qi2 brings the magnetic alignment benefits of MagSafe to a broader array of devices, ensuring that your phone is perfectly positioned for efficient power transfer every single time.

For most users, the "Goldilocks" zone of charging is a 2-in-1 or 3-in-1 station. These devices minimize cable spaghetti by consolidating power inputs into a single brick. However, not all chargers are created equal. Factors such as "StandBy" mode compatibility, the presence of dedicated Apple Watch fast-charging modules, and the build quality of the magnetic mount are the primary differentiators between a $50 budget option and a $150 premium station.
Chronology: The Evolution of the Charging Station
The journey toward the modern wireless charging station began with the introduction of the first-generation Qi standard, which was notorious for its "sweet spot" issues—if your phone wasn’t placed perfectly, you’d wake up to a dead battery.
- The MagSafe Revolution: Apple’s introduction of MagSafe in 2020 changed the game. By embedding a ring of magnets into the iPhone 12, Apple ensured perfect alignment, effectively solving the primary pain point of wireless charging.
- The Rise of 3-in-1s: As the Apple ecosystem expanded, manufacturers began building "trees" or "docks" that could handle the phone, watch, and earbuds simultaneously. Early models were often flimsy or struggled with heat dissipation.
- The Qi2 Era: Starting with the iPhone 15 and 16, and moving into the latest Android flagships like the Google Pixel 10 series, Qi2 has standardized magnetic charging. This is the current benchmark for any serious recommendation, offering 15W of consistent power without requiring proprietary Apple-only hardware.
Top Recommendations: The Best in Class
The Best 2-in-1 Charger: Belkin UltraCharge 2-in-1 Foldable
Belkin’s latest UltraCharge 2-in-1 has officially unseated previous industry favorites. By supporting Qi2 25W charging, it provides a faster, more future-proof experience. Its foldable design makes it a rare hybrid—equally at home on a permanent nightstand or inside a travel bag.

- Key Feature: A secondary USB-C port on the back allows for trickle-charging an Apple Watch or other peripherals.
- Verdict: With a compact 45-watt power adapter included in the box, it offers the best value-to-performance ratio currently available.
The Best 3-in-1 Charger: Twelve South HiRise 3 Deluxe
For those who prioritize aesthetics, the Twelve South HiRise 3 Deluxe is a masterclass in design. It features a weighted base that stays firmly planted, an adjustable iPhone mount that rotates for StandBy mode, and a dedicated, flip-up fast charger for the Apple Watch. Its ability to handle international power needs out of the box makes it a favorite for global travelers.
Notable 3-in-1 Contenders
- Noco X Grid XDS3 ($130): Exceptionally well-made with a wide, stable footprint. While it is less portable, its build quality is industrial-grade.
- Anker Prime 3-in-1 ($150): A feature-packed "tree" that includes an interactive display and active cooling. It is ideal for the user who wants real-time data on their charging speeds and battery health, though some may find the screen design a bit polarizing.
Supporting Data: Why MagSafe and Qi2 Matter
To understand why we emphasize these standards, one must look at the efficiency loss in traditional wireless charging. A standard Qi pad often loses 20 to 30 percent of its energy as heat due to misalignment.
- MagSafe/Qi2 Efficiency: Because these magnets ensure a coil-to-coil connection, heat generation is minimized, and the charging cycle is consistent.
- Power Output: While standard wireless charging often caps out at 7.5W for iPhones, Qi2 and MagSafe-certified chargers enable the full 15W (and in some cases, 25W) experience.
- Material Science: Our testing indicates that stations utilizing high-density materials—such as the metal chassis of the Nomad Base One Max or the weighted bases of the Belkin and Twelve South models—are less likely to "droop" or slide during one-handed removal of a phone.
Official Responses and Manufacturer Perspectives
Manufacturers like Zens and Belkin have noted that the biggest hurdle in the current market is the "case problem." Many consumers purchase inexpensive, non-magnetic cases that effectively neutralize the magnetic pull of these chargers.

"The most common complaint we hear is that a charger isn’t working, but in 90 percent of cases, it is a third-party non-MagSafe case interfering with the magnetic coupling," says a spokesperson from a leading accessory manufacturer. Our testing confirms this: if you want a reliable charge, ensure your case is specifically rated for MagSafe or Qi2 compatibility.
Furthermore, many manufacturers are moving away from proprietary barrel-jack power cables in favor of standard USB-C. This is a massive win for consumers, as it allows for easier replacement of cables if they fray over time.
Implications: The Future of Your Nightstand
The landscape of charging is moving toward a "total desk" solution. We are seeing more modular systems, like the Scosche BaseLynx 2.0, which allow users to "build" their charging station based on their specific hardware.

However, there is a clear warning for consumers: avoid "cheap" uncertified hardware. During our testing, several off-brand chargers failed to provide consistent thermal management, resulting in "hot" phones that would eventually throttle their own charging speed for safety. When your phone costs upwards of $1,000, saving $20 on a generic, uncertified charging station is a false economy.
Summary of What to Look For:
- Certification: Always look for the "Qi2" or "Made for MagSafe" logo.
- Cable Port: Prioritize devices that use USB-C for power input, not barrel ports.
- StandBy Compatibility: Ensure the charger holds the phone at an angle that allows the device to trigger its StandBy or Nightstand modes.
- Weight: A light charger is a nuisance; look for a weighted base that allows for one-handed operation.
A Note on Compatibility
While these chargers are designed with the Apple ecosystem in mind, the advent of Qi2 means that future Android devices will be able to utilize these same magnetic mounts. If you are a household with mixed devices, keep an eye on the "Qi2" label on the packaging; that is your guarantee of cross-platform functionality.
